quote:

How the frick does the "Appalachian State-Western Illinois FCS playoff game" have any affect on LSU and Boise State when neither played either of these teams?


That is not even the worst part. That single game (Appy vs W Ill) apparently affected every teams SOS in the Colley poll.

Somehow 11 of the teams SOS increased, and the other 14 decreased.

Stanford (somehow) took the biggest hit, losing .65 points from their SOS.

VA Tech got the biggest boost with .51 points added to their SOS.

Every ranked Big XII, ACC, WAC and MWC team had their SOS increased. And likewise, every other team, including ALL SEC teams had their SOS decreased.

quote:

How the frick does the "Appalachian State-Western Illinois FCS playoff game" have any affect on LSU and Boise State when neither played either of these teams?


Common opponents, brah. App st (and Western Illinois) played somebody, who played somebody, who played somebody, etc. etc.

Colley does some crazy (pretty creative, imo) ways to include FCS teams into his computer rankings. You can read how he does it on his site. And I'm glad he does. Wins or the occasional lost should be counted or have an effect on the BCS or FBS team rankings.

Of course, no one would have said anything or would have known, if the rankings were released correctly the first time.
